1 11279102 Sorting nexin 6, a novel SNX, interacts with the transforming growth factor-beta family of receptor serine-threonine kinases.
2 11279102 Human SNX1, -2, and -4 have been proposed to play a role in receptor trafficking and have been shown to bind to several receptor tyrosine kinases, including receptors for epidermal growth factor, platelet-derived growth factor, and insulin as well as the long form of the leptin receptor, a glycoprotein 130-associated receptor.
3 11279102 We now describe a novel member of this family, SNX6, which interacts with members of the transforming growth factor-beta family of receptor serine-threonine kinases.
4 11279102 Of the type II receptors, SNX6 was found to interact strongly with ActRIIB and more moderately with wild type and kinase-defective mutants of TbetaRII.
5 11279102 Conversely, SNX6 behaved similarly to the other SNX proteins in its interactions with receptor tyrosine kinases.
6 11334431 No evidence for linkage or for diabetes-associated mutations in the activin type 2B receptor gene (ACVR2B) in French patients with mature-onset diabetes of the young or type 2 diabetes.
7 11334431 For transmembrane signaling, activins bind directly to activin receptor type 2A (ACVR2A) or 2B (ACVR2B).

10 15180456 Activins, myostatin and related TGF-beta family members as novel therapeutic targets for endocrine, metabolic and immune disorders.
11 15180456 Recent studies have revealed that activins and myostatin signal through activin type II receptors (ActRIIA and ActRIIB) and their activities are regulated by extracellular binding proteins, follistatins and follistatin-related gene (FLRG).
12 21353874 Activin receptor type IIB (ActRIIB) belongs to a type II transforming growth factor-β (TGF-β) serine/threonine kinase receptor family which is integral to the activin and myostatin signaling pathway.
13 21353874 Actvin and myostatin bind to activin type II receptors (ActRIIA and ActRIIB), and the glycine-serine-rich domains of type I receptors are phosphorylated by type II receptors.
